All Hail Caesar!

The first trailer from Rise of the Planet of the Apes has just been released and I have to say that I am pleasantly surprised.

Directed by Rupert Wyatt (The Escapist) and written by Rick Jaffa and Amanda Silver (The Relic) based upon the original novel by Pierre Boulle. Starring James Franco (127 Hours) as Will Rodman and Andy Serkis (The Lord of the Rings trilogy) as Caesar, this prequel charts the uprising of the apes caused by genetic engineering experiments and set in modern say San Francisco.
